I have found an Austin Healy Sprite in a pole barn. No title from previous Owners.  Looking to sell, but need to apply for title in Indiana.  How do I.D. this thing for model/type?  I sent pix to bugeye.com who are confident it's Sprite.  No idea of year.
I.D. plate above radiator and on side of engine are readable.

Yes, it has to be pre 1975 They stopped making them in 1970 when British Leyland cut ties with Healey.... last ones to the US were 1969.. from 1971 on it was just the Midget... If it does not have outside door handles, or roll up windows it is a 1961-1964 Mark II If it has roll down windows, it's either a 1964- 1966 Mark III with a 1098cc engine, or a 1966-1969 Mark IV with a 1275cc engine - 1966-67 has an all metal dash.. 1968-1969 has the padded pillow dash, 1969 has side marker lights..
